How much do online matchmaking j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 31, 2026, the average yearly pay for online matchmaking in Delaware is $40,631.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$25,000.00 and $43,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an online matchmaking?

An Online Matchmaking job involves helping individuals find compatible partners based on their preferences, interests, and values. Matchmakers use online platforms, databases, and communication tools to assess client profiles, suggest potential matches, and offer relationship advice. The role may include interviewing clients, analyzing compatibility factors, and facilitating introductions. Some positions focus on personalized matchmaking, while others manage dating app community engagement. Effective communication, empathy, and an understanding of relationship dynamics are key skills in this field.

What does an online matchmaker do?

As an Online Matchmaker, your daily responsibilities often include interviewing new clients to understand their preferences and relationship goals, analyzing client profiles, and suggesting potential matches. You’ll communicate regularly with clients through email, phone, or video calls, providing guidance and feedback throughout the matchmaking process. Coordinating introductions, following up on match outcomes, and maintaining accurate records using specialized software are also important tasks. This role requires balancing personalized attention with managing several client accounts, all while maintaining confidentiality and professionalism.

What skills and qualifications are needed for an online matchmaker?

To thrive as an Online Matchmaker, you need strong interpersonal skills, an understanding of relationship dynamics, and often a background in psychology, social work, or a related field.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) tools, matchmaking software platforms, and online communication systems is typically required. Exceptional listening, empathy, and conflict resolution skills help you connect with clients and facilitate compatible matches. These skills are crucial for building trust, ensuring client satisfaction, and successfully helping clients form meaningful connections.

How to get hired as an online matchmaker?

To get hired as an online matchmaker, develop strong interpersonal and communication skills, and gain experience in relationship counseling or customer service. Building a professional profile, obtaining relevant certifications, and demonstrating success in matching clients can improve your chances of employment in this field.

Staples is the country's largest operator of office supplies superstores, offering a vast selection of products at low prices, primarily to small business owners. The company has a strong online presence and operates over 994 stores in the U.S. and 40 warehouses/fulfillment centers. The company was founded by Leo Kahn and Thomas G. Stemberg, and opened its first store in Brighton, Massachusetts on May 1, 1986. By 1996, it had reached the Fortune 500, and later acquired the office supplies company Quill Corporation. Staples provides office and school supplies, office furnishings, electronics, software, snack and beauty products, as well as offering printing and technological services.
